Output 60614c94d98201eb541defaf201158b4de9e1ff574beec4a8878469547884f73:7

value
694466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1aef02ebc66400abd972fe674bc7de43e6d00df OP_EQUAL
address
3HtX6RBzQv2wP7fuWAN2bKGXp3J24GHddz
transaction
60614c94d98201eb541defaf201158b4de9e1ff574beec4a8878469547884f73
confirmations
323002
spent
true